    Jim's is paradise for gun lovers. Sure Jim's sells vaults, clothing, cleaning kits, holsters and a ton other gun related items. But what makes Jim's special is the sheer quantity of firearms they have in stock. Jim's has a huge variety of guns. I'm not talking about your run of the mill Glock or Springfield XD. Sure they have those, but they also have the largest amount of 1911 style guns that I have ever seen in one place. There were every type of 1911 from entry level to $4000 custom pistols. It was truly amazing. Want to look like bullet tooth Tony from the movie Snatch? Jim's had several Desert Eagles in stock. Want to have a gun in case of bear attack? Jim's had both the .460 Magnum and .500 Magnum S&W revolvers. The staff at Jim's was very friendly and helpful on both of my recent visits. On my most recent visit I was fortunate enough to have a ling discussion about the different types of 1911 extractors. I loved every minute of it. Making the experience even better is that Jim's has very fair prices. I found them to be cheaper than the big box national stores, plus they had several very reasonable consignment guns.     Stopped in just for the hell of it today...wanted to check ammo prices mainly....The family really…read moredoesn't know what to get me for Christmas (they AIN'T gonna buy me a new pistola, that's for sure!!!) and I told them just get me some ammo for my .45 AP or my Ruger SR9...They started asking questions as to how much is it gonna cost? The ammo prices are in line with pretty much everybody else... roughly $25 for a box of 50 for target ammo (FMJ) and roughly $25 for Personal Protection ammo in a box of 20 to 25 depending upon manufacturer (hollow point). They have a good selection of Bianchi concealed carry holsters, gun safes and a pretty damn impressive array of handguns, shotguns and rifles for sale....wish I'da been rolling in the dough cause I woulda been making some big ticket purchases!!!
